Heavy ion beam irradiation on the cosmic X-ray polarimeter
- 1. RIKEN, Wako, Saitama (Japan)
Description
Iron beam with an energy of 500 MeV/n and proton beam with an energy of 160 MeV were irradiated to the gas electron multiplier (GEM) which is the key device of our cosmic X-ray polarimeter. The GEM was properly operated at a nominal operation voltage after 40 years equivalent irradiation. (author)
